Ovid MEDLINE is a leading source for biomedical scholarly literature and research, providing more than 23 million citations from over 5,600 indexed, scholarly, and peer-reviewed journals

CINAHL Plus with full text provides full-text access to more than 370 journals. It covers paramedicine, allied health, nursing, biomedicine, alternative/ complementary medicine, and consumer health. It also provides health care books, selected conference proceedings, standards of practice, audiovisuals, book chapters and more.

Embase provides over 30 million abstracts and indices from more than 8,500 published, peer-reviewed journals, as well as in-press publications and conferences. Fields covered include Pharmacology and Pharmaceutical Science; Pharmacoeconomics; Toxicology; Evidence-Based Medicine; Biotechnology and Bioengineering; Medical Devices; Drug Research and Development; Clinical Investigations; Public, Occupational, and Environmental Health Research and Policy Management and more.

 

Emcare provides current and relevant content across core topics including Emergency Services. Emcare covers 3,500 international, currently indexed, peer-reviewed journals and contains over 5 million records. 

TOXINZ is an online poisons database. It offers information on chemicals and chemical products, pharmaceuticals, plants and hazardous creatures. All content in TOXINZ is continuously reviewed and updated in real time. Content is fully referenced with direct links to PubMed. 

AMBER - the home of ambulance services research. AMBER contains records of published research authored by NHS staff working in Ambulance Services in England.
